What are blackheads?

Blackheads are the first stage of acne, before bacteria invades the pore which results in infection and inflammation. These lesions typically occur around puberty when hormones begin to increase. The excess hormones result in stimulation of the oil gland, called sebaceous glands. This results in excess oil production in the pores, causing the formation of blackheads. When blackheads form, they are tiny dark spots caused by a small plug in the opening pore of the skin. They are usually yellowish or blackish in color and can not only appear on the face, but on your back, on your neck as well as other areas that are rich in sebaceous glands.

Tip for Removing Blackheads

Well, actually this is a tip for how NOT to remove blackheads. But it is an important one. You should avoid squeezing, pressing, picking and otherwise manipulating your blackheads in any way. This will help you reduce acne scarring and infection.

How To Remove Blackheads

The following blackhead removal treatment should be done no more than once per week. You will need a large towel, a large bowl of boiling water and a blackhead cleanser or wash. You can choose an over the counter blackhead remover for this or you can make your own using baking soda and water. Put boiling water into the bowl and put your face over it. Now cover your head with the towel and stay there for about five minutes. After your pores have opened up from the steam, gently use your OTC blackhead remover or your baking soda and water treatment. Be gentle whenever you are cleansing your face to avoid irritation. Then splash your face with warm water to rinse and finish by splashing very cold water on your face to close your pores. If you continue this process once a week, you should see an improvement in your blackheads. Don't forget to wash your face with a mild cleanser twice each day to avoid oily face skin and more blackheads.
